Програмування

Питання та відповіді для професійних та ентузіастів-програмістів

11
Виклик функцій асинхронізації / очікування паралельно
Наскільки я розумію, в ES7 / ES2016 введення множинних awaitкодів буде працювати аналогічно ланцюгу .then()з обіцянками, тобто, вони будуть виконуватись одна за одною, а не паралельно. Так, наприклад, у нас є цей код: await someCall(); await anotherCall(); Я правильно розумію, що anotherCall()буде викликано лише тоді, коли someCall()буде завершено? Який найелегантніший …

6
Максимальна довжина текстуального подання адреси IPv6?
Я хочу зберігати дані, повернені $_SERVER["REMOTE_ADDR"]в PHP, у поле БД, дуже проста задача, насправді. Проблема полягає в тому, що я не можу знайти належну інформацію про максимальну довжину текстуального подання адреси IPv6, через що надає веб-сервер $_SERVER["REMOTE_ADDR"]. Мені не цікаво перетворювати текстове представлення у 128 біт, за кодом зазвичай кодується …
430 ip  ip-address  ipv6 

5
Entity Framework VS LINQ для SQL VS ADO.NET із збереженими процедурами? [зачинено]
Зачинено. Це питання не відповідає вказівкам щодо переповнення стека . Наразі відповіді не приймаються. Хочете вдосконалити це питання? Оновіть питання, щоб воно було тематичним для переповнення стека. Закритий минулого року . Як би ви оцінили кожну з них з точки зору: Продуктивність Швидкість розвитку Акуратний, інтуїтивно зрозумілий, бездоганний код Гнучкість …

16
Чому я не повинен загортати кожен блок у "спробувати" - "зловити"?
Я завжди був думкою, що якщо метод може кинути виняток, тоді нерозумно не захищати цей виклик за допомогою значущого блоку спробу. Я щойно опублікував " Ви ВЖЕ завжди повинні завершувати дзвінки, які можуть робити спроби, ловити блоки. "на це питання і мені сказали, що це" надзвичайно погана порада "- я …

17
Інструмент для видалення / видалення JavaScript [закрито]
Зачинено. Це питання не відповідає вказівкам щодо переповнення стека . Наразі відповіді не приймаються. Хочете вдосконалити це питання? Оновіть питання, щоб воно було тематичним для переповнення стека. Закрито 6 років тому . Чи є сценарії командного рядка та / або онлайн-інструменти, які можуть скасувати ефекти мінімізації, подібні до того, як …

14
MySQL Error 1153 - Отримав пакет, більший за байт 'max_allowed_packet'
Я імпортую дамп MySQL і отримую наступну помилку. $ mysql foo < foo.sql ERROR 1153 (08S01) at line 96: Got a packet bigger than 'max_allowed_packet' bytes Мабуть, в базі даних є вкладення, що робить дуже великі вставки. Це на моїй локальній машині, Mac з MySQL 5, встановлений з пакету MySQL. …

25
Як у формі Джанго я можу зробити поле читання лише (або відключене), щоб воно не могло редагуватись?
Як зробити форму "Джанго", як зробити поле лише для читання (або вимкнено)? Коли форма використовується для створення нового запису, усі поля повинні бути включені - але коли запис знаходиться в режимі оновлення, деякі поля потрібно лише для читання. Наприклад, при створенні нової Itemмоделі всі поля повинні бути редаговані, але, оновлюючи …
430 django  forms  field  readonly 

7
Як шукати всі завантажені сценарії в Інструментах для розробників Chrome?
У Firebug ви можете шукати текст, і він буде шукати його у всіх сценаріях, завантажених на сторінку. Чи можна це зробити в інструментах для розробників Chrome під час налагодження сценарію клієнта? Я спробував це, але, схоже, шукаю лише сценарій, який я відкрив, а не решту, що знаходиться на сторінці. Я …


5
Альтернатива google finance api [закрито]
Зачинено. Це питання не відповідає вказівкам щодо переповнення стека . Наразі відповіді не приймаються. Хочете вдосконалити це питання? Оновіть питання, щоб воно було тематичним для переповнення стека. Закрито 5 років тому . Я хотів за допомогою API Google Finance отримати дані про акції про компанію, але цей API застарілий з …

10
Не обіцянки - це лише зворотні дзвінки?
Я розробляв JavaScript вже кілька років, і взагалі не розумію суєти щодо обіцянок. Здається, що все, що я роблю, - це зміни: api(function(result){ api2(function(result2){ api3(function(result3){ // do work }); }); }); Яка я могла б використовувати бібліотеку, як асинхронність, у будь-якому випадку: api().then(function(result){ api2().then(function(result2){ api3().then(function(result3){ // do work }); }); …

20
Чи можна відключити мережу в iOS Simulator?
Я намагаюся налагодити деяку непослідовну поведінку, яку я бачу в додатку, який отримує свої основні дані з Інтернету. Я не бачу проблем у тренажері, лише на пристрої, тому я хотів би відтворити мережеве та середовище підключення в тренажері. Чи є якийсь спосіб відключення мережі в тренажері? (Я підключаюсь до Mac …

22
Laravel вимагає розширення PHP Mcrypt
Я намагаюся використовувати migrateфункцію Laravel 4на OSX. Однак я отримую таку помилку: Laravel requires the Mcrypt PHP extension. Наскільки я розумію, це вже ввімкнено (див. Зображення нижче). Що не так, і як це можна виправити?
429 php  laravel  laravel-4  mcrypt 

11
find -exec з декількома командами
Я намагаюся без особливих успіхів використовувати find -exec з кількома командами. Хтось знає, чи можливі такі команди, як наведено нижче? find *.txt -exec echo "$(tail -1 '{}'),$(ls '{}')" \; В основному, я намагаюся надрукувати останній рядок кожного файлу txt у поточному каталозі та надрукувати в кінці рядка, кома з наступним …
429 bash  find 

26
Apache2: 'AH01630: клієнту відмовлено в налаштуваннях сервера'
Я отримую цю помилку при спробі отримати доступ до localhost через браузер. AH01630: client denied by server configuration Я перевірив дозволи на папки свого сайту, використовуючи: sudo chmod 777 -R * Ось мій файл конфігурації: <VirtualHost *:80> ServerAdmin webmaster@localhost DocumentRoot /home/user-name/www/myproject <Directory /> Options FollowSymLinks AllowOverride all Allow from all …

Використовуючи наш веб-сайт, ви визнаєте, що прочитали та зрозуміли наші Політику щодо файлів cookie та Політику конфіденційності.
Licensed under cc by-sa 3.0 with attribution required.